Someone who looses at all contests and give-aways
I'll never win sxephil's give-aways because I'm a monkey puncher!
by Buttface65436 August 05, 2011
Someone stupid enough to click banner ads, i.e. the ad encouraging you to punch the monkey to win.
His PC is all clogged up with spyware because he keeps clicking on banner ads. What a monkey puncher!
by RealityCheque April 25, 2008